Georgia's Bennett arrested on public intoxication charge

Georgia quarterback Stetson Bennett was arrested on a public intoxication charge Sunday morning in Dallas, police confirmed to WFAA's Rebecca Lopez.
Bennett was arrested around 6 a.m. and taken to a detention center after reports of a man banging on doors. A police release didn't confirm if the man was Bennett, Lopez adds.
Officers determined Bennett was intoxicated when they arrived, per the release. He was released from the detention center before 12 p.m. ET.
Bennett has won back-to-back national championships with the Bulldogs. He's projected to be a mid-to-late-round selection in the 2023 NFL Draft.
